"ヒーター"というクラスがあります。プロパティの1つが "designstatus"という文字列です。 3つの選択肢のいずれかにプロパティを制限したい。 "現在の"、 "廃止された"、 "設計されていない"。どうすればいい?プロパティのリストを定義する方法
0
A
答えて
4
Enum
を使用できます。例:
Public Enum DesignStatus
Current
Obsolete
NotDesigned
End Enum
0
あなたが列挙型を使用しますが、列挙型は整数であるとして、これは完全にあなたがやりたいことするつもりはないので、私はこれに似た何かをすることをお勧めこれを行うことができます。
Public Enum DesignStatuses
Current
Obsolete
NotDesigned
End Enum
だから、あなたはあなたが行うことができます使用していることを列挙の実際の文字列名を取得する必要がある場合:実際の名前を返します
DesignStatus.ToString("G")
値の代わりに定数。
関連する問題
- 1. プロパティのエイリアスを定義する方法
- 2. FAKE:MSBuildプロパティを定義する方法は?
- 3. リストの表示方法Object.definePropertyで定義されたプロパティ
- 4. 定義されたすべてのプロパティをプログラムでリストする方法は?
- 5. プリズム内のプロパティ内の領域を定義する方法
- 6. オブジェクト指向Matlabの派生プロパティを定義する方法
- 7. OWLでプロパティのドメインを定義する方法は?
- 8. リストのプロパティを作成する方法
- 9. Beanのプロパティをリストする方法
- 10. vb6でリストの配列を定義する方法は?
- 11. SharePointリストのIPアドレスフィールドを定義する方法
- 12. Angular2 Plain JSで入力プロパティを定義する方法
- 13. モデルファーストで並行性プロパティを定義する方法
- 14. j2meフォームguiプロパティを定義する方法
- 15. ソリューションファイルにプロジェクトOutputPathを定義する方法は? (またはソリューションファイルでカスタムプロジェクトのプロパティを指定する方法)
- 16. Groovyのプロパティ定義
- 17. Javascriptオブジェクトのプロパティと関数を定義する新しい方法ですか?
- 18. 春に必須のプロパティを定義する方法はありますか?
- 19. 可変プロパティ名を持つオブジェクトのJSONスキーマを定義する方法
- 20. 特定のプロパティを使用してオブジェクトのリストを検索する方法
- 21. "未定義プロパティ:stdClass"
- 22. 特定のプロパティのオブジェクトの総称リストを結合する方法
- 23. の定義方法
- 24. 私のクラスで効果的なget setプロパティを定義する方法
- 25. リストの順序を定義する
- 26. エラーメッセージとエラーコードのリストを定義する
- 27. Ploneのデフォルトビューを定義する方法
- 28. オーディオファイルのパスを定義する方法
- 29. 指定されたプロパティとソート順のリストをソートする方法
- 30. IBOutletをプロパティとして定義する方法を教えてください。